1. About Property Division Law in Heilbronn, Germany

In Germany, property division after a marriage is primarily governed by the concept of Zugewinnausgleich, the equalization of accrued gains. This means assets acquired during the marriage are assessed and redistributed to reflect each spouse's gains, with separate assets largely excluded unless expressly shared. In Heilbronn, as in the rest of Baden-Wurttemberg, this process is typically addressed within divorce proceedings at the local Familiengericht housed in the Amtsgericht (for Heilbronn, the local court is Amtsgericht Heilbronn).

The default regime in most marriages is Zugewinngemeinschaft, which assumes joint ownership of gains acquired during the marriage, while each spouse retains ownership of separate property. Spouses may opt out of this regime through a notarized Ehevertrag (prenuptial or postnuptial agreement) to alter how assets are treated in the event of divorce. Legal counsel can help determine whether a prenup or postnup is advantageous in your situation.

For Heilbronn residents, it is important to understand that property division is tightly linked to disclosure of assets, valuations, and possibly pension rights (Versorgungsausgleich) as part of the divorce process. 2. Why You May Need a Lawyer

Asset division cases in Heilbronn involve complex disclosures, valuations, and court procedures. A lawyer helps protect your rights and avoids costly mistakes.

  • Hidden assets discovered during divorce - Your spouse may conceal a side business, real estate, or offshore accounts in and around Heilbronn, making accurate asset disclosure essential for a fair Zugewinnausgleich.
  • Valuation of a Heilbronn property portfolio - If you own real estate in Heilbronn or nearby areas, precise appraisals and tax considerations are critical to an accurate asset split.
  • Family business assets and shareholder interests - A business run from Heilbronn or the region requires careful valuation, potential buyouts, and consideration of corporate structures.
  • Cross-border or multi-jurisdiction assets - Assets held abroad or in other EU countries necessitate coordination across jurisdictions and careful legal strategy.
  • Dividend or pension rights involved in the divorce - The Versorgungs-Ausgleich (pension rights) can be complex and requires expert calculation and negotiation.
  • Contested asset disclosures and court proceedings - If your spouse disputes asset figures, a lawyer is often necessary to obtain orders for financial disclosure (Vermögensauskunft) and secure a fair result.

3. Local Laws Overview

The following are key statutes and procedural rules that govern property division in Heilbronn and most of Germany. They are federal in scope but are applied through local courts in Baden-Wurttemberg, including Heilbronn.

Bürgerliches Gesetzbuch (BGB) - Zugewinnausgleich - This is the main framework for calculating and enforcing the equalization of accrued gains at divorce. The BGB governs how assets and gains acquired during the marriage are valued and allocated between spouses. For official text, see the Federal Civil Code on Gesetze-im-Internet: https://www.gesetze-im-internet.de/bgb/

Gesetz über das Verfahren in Familiensachen und in den Angelegenheiten der freiwilligen Gerichtsbarkeit (FamFG) - This statute governs the procedural framework for family matters including divorce and asset division, including hearings, filings, and case management in courts such as the Familiengericht at the Amtsgericht Heilbronn. See: https://www.gesetze-im-internet.de/famfg/

4. Frequently Asked Questions

What is Zugewinnausgleich and how does it affect my Heilbronn divorce?

Zugewinnausgleich is the equalization of gains earned during the marriage. In Heilbronn, the court calculates each spouse's net gains and splits the difference, subject to any prenuptial agreements or waivers. The process requires full disclosure of assets and liabilities.

How do I start a property division claim in Heilbronn?

You typically file for divorce at the Amtsgericht Heilbronn, with property division addressed within the divorce proceedings. A lawyer can help prepare the necessary financial statements and valuation requests to the court.

What documents are usually needed for a first consultation in Heilbronn?

Common documents include marriage certificates, birth certificates for children, property deeds, bank statements, loan documents, and any business valuations. If assets are abroad, gather comparable records in those jurisdictions.

How much does a property division lawyer in Heilbronn cost?

Costs depend on case length, complexity, and the attorney's fee structure. Typical initial consultations may be lower, with final costs rising if expert valuations or court hearings are required.

What is the typical timeline for a Zugewinnausgleich case in Baden-Württemberg?

Divorce and asset division can take several months to over a year, depending on asset complexity and dispute levels. A lawyer can help set milestones and manage court schedules to minimize delays.

Do I need a lawyer for the Zugewinnausgleich process in Heilbronn?

A lawyer is highly advisable for asset valuation, disclosure, and court negotiations. While you can proceed pro se, professional representation increases the likelihood of a fair outcome and reduces risk of errors.

Is mediation available for property division disputes in Heilbronn?

Yes, mediation or conciliatory talks are commonly encouraged before or during court proceedings. A lawyer can help prepare for mediation and draft settlement terms if negotiations succeed.

What’s the difference between a prenup and the default Zugewinnausgleich?

A prenup (Ehevertrag) may modify or replace the default regime. Without one, assets and accrued gains are divided under the Zugewinnausgleich framework at divorce.

When should I consider a prenup in Heilbronn?

Consider a prenup if you or your spouse own a family business, plan to acquire significant assets, or want to tailor asset distribution to personal circumstances. It should be signed before marriage or during a lawful adjustment period with proper counsel.

Where can I find public court forms for Heilbronn family cases?

Public forms are available via the Justizportal BW and local court portals. A lawyer can provide the correct forms and ensure they are filed correctly.

Can I get legal aid or subsidized counsel for a property division case in Heilbronn?

Yes, there are options for legal aid or cost assistance in Germany (Verfahrenskostenhilfe) if you meet income thresholds. A lawyer can assess eligibility and help apply.

Do assets outside Germany count in the Zugewinnausgleich?

Yes, foreign assets can count if they were acquired during the marriage. Asset valuation may require cross-border appraisals and cooperation between jurisdictions.
